Covario Reports Soaring Increases in Mobile Search Spend

SAN DIEGO, CA — (Marketwired) — 10/29/14 — Covario, Inc., a leading search and content marketing firm, today issued its for Q3 2014, reporting a 16% increase in total global paid search advertising spend over the previous quarter, and a 28% increase year-over-year among the company–s high tech, consumer electronics and retail clients. The increase in media expenditures can be attributed to a 39% rise in traffic and 20% rise in impressions over 2013. The soaring use of mobile is the driving factor behind these substantial increases in media spends. Today, mobile accounts for 33% of total search budgets globally, a 180% increase over Q3 2013.

Alex Funk, the study–s author and Covario–s director of global paid media strategy said, “There are one billion active Android users, and Apple now sells 10 million devices during the first weekend a new mobile product is made available. Big brands are quickly adjusting spends to capture this rapidly growing demand.”

Globally, cost-per-clicks decreased 8% compared to 2013. According to Funk, this decrease is again driven by the larger percentage of mobile device traffic, which has been at a heavy discount compared to desktop bids.

Based on these in depth study findings, Funk advises advertisers to budget for a 15 to 20 percent increase in paid search spending in Q4 and moving into 2015. He advises a heavy allocation of those funds be spent with Google over other major search engines. This advice varies slightly in the EMEA and APAC regions, and is detailed clearly in this report.

Leveraging 31 quarters of data and now in its eighth year of production, Covario–s Global Paid Search Spend Analysis report shares valuable expertise relative to the spending patterns of a unique customer set with the intent of helping Covario clients with paid search planning assumptions and budget management.
